Transaction e62a416c5de32ae72b660e80b6b979828d5d8db77a4330a83ad68f31f32b86b8

2 Input
2 Outputs
  • e62a416c5de32ae72b660e80b6b979828d5d8db77a4330a83ad68f31f32b86b8:0
  • value  8210181
    address  38jeQhVmZhtKWp4YjEjHK6WAsqQQz1fWQ5
  • e62a416c5de32ae72b660e80b6b979828d5d8db77a4330a83ad68f31f32b86b8:1
  • value  5956409
    address  32FDXVQeqcw1sP8HKYF3iZsmRL133ZpSfr